Bluetooth: Remove typedef bluecard_info_t
The Linux kernel coding style guidelines suggest not using typedefs
for structure types. This patch gets rid of the typedef for
bluecard_info_t. Also, the name of the struct is changed to drop the _t,
to make the name look less typedef-like.
The following Coccinelle semantic patch detects the case:
@tn@
identifier i;
type td;
@@
-typedef
struct i { ... }
-td
;
@@
type tn.td;
identifier tn.i;
@@
-td
+ struct i
